May Day: The DruidessLady Flora Debenham discovers from her dying mother that her father was really a Druid. On a secret mission to find him at her late mother's request, Flora sets out. She convinces her uncle to let her take her cousin's place as Lord Ricard's betrothed. The lord's forest is the hiding spot of the Druids and Flora must find it.The KnightLord Ricard Wellington is awoken in the middle of the night to find out his betrothed has been replaced. Lady Flora is beautiful but holds a deep secret. She also keeps sneaking off to the forest. Ricard doesn't have time for a disobedient bride, because he is on a hunt to find and kill the Druids who were responsible for the death of his parents.Will vengeance prevent the seeds of love from blooming?

This book is full of May Day jokes and recipes for tasty treats, such as Sweet Butterflies and May Day Candy Pizza. Jokes, puns, one-liners, and riddles accompany the recipes in bursts on each page, which adds just the right amount of humor So, celebrate the day with merrymaking and munchies. This practical, comprehensive, and engaging introduction to the American judicial system is designed primarily for undergraduate students in criminal justice, liberal arts, political science, and beginning law. It differs from other texts not only by delivering an insider’s view of the courts, but also by demonstrating how the judicial process operates at the intersection of law and politics. Unlike the many dull and inaccessible texts in this field, May It Please The Court conveys the human drama of civil and criminal litigation. With an updated epilogue, case studies, and discussion questions, this third edition is a robust resource for criminal justice students.
